MAG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

129 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MAG Silver (MAG)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$527M — down 24% from $691M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of MAG and 15 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 38 trimmed existing stakes and 40 added.

The largest buyer was First Eagle Investment Management, adding an estimated $10.8M. The largest seller was VanEck Associates, cutting an estimated $15M.
